One of the foremost elements to evaluate when purchasing an air dryer is its type. There are primarily three types of air dryers: refrigerant, desiccant, and membrane dryers. Each has unique characteristics that make them suitable for different applications. According to a report by the Compressed Air and Gas Institute, refrigerant air dryers are the most common type used in North America, accounting for about 75% of the market.
Efficiency is another substantial factor. The compressed air industry has made significant advancements in energy efficiency. As per a 2021 study by the U.S. Department of Energy, using efficient compressed air dryers can save businesses up to 30% on energy costs compared to outdated models. Buyers are encouraged to look for models that have received Energy Star certification, which indicates superior energy performance.
Temperature and pressure ratings are also essential specifications. Most applications require dryers that can operate effectively within a specific temperature range. For instance, a dryer’s inlet temperature generally should not exceed 100°F for optimal performance. Furthermore, knowing the required pressure dew point is vital, as various applications may demand different dew points, sometimes as low as -40°F.
In addition to technical specifications, it’s imperative to consider the size and capacity of the air dryer. It's recommended to choose a model that can accommodate your peak air demand, factoring in future growth. The Compressed Air Challenge suggests that properly sized air dryers can result in an efficiency improvement of up to 50%.
Maintenance and operational costs are often overlooked but are crucial for long-term budgeting. According to a report from the International Society for Automation, improper maintenance can lead to performance drops and increased energy consumption, costing companies up to 10% more annually. Investing in preventative maintenance plans can significantly counteract these costs.
Another important factor is the material and construction quality of the air dryer. High-quality construction ensures longevity and reliability in harsh environments. Stainless steel is often preferred for its resistance to corrosion and wear, extending the lifespan of the equipment. A study by the Air & Dust Pollution journal found that quality materials could improve the service life of compressed air dryers by as much as 25%.
Noise levels are also increasingly significant, especially for facilities that prioritize a quieter working environment. Many modern air dryers now feature advanced insulation technologies that help reduce noise levels to acceptable standards, typically below 85 dB, as highlighted in a report by the Association of Home Appliance Manufacturers.
Last but not least, evaluating the brand and warranty offered is fundamental. Reputable manufacturers often provide warranties that reflect their confidence in the product. An article by Equipment Today emphasized that a longer warranty period often correlates with higher quality and reliability, which can lead to fewer maintenance issues over the life of the dryer.
